About this experience
Experience traditional Japan at Kotonoha, a charming café in a beautifully restored old Japanese house. Begin with a Japanese calligraphy lesson taught by a professional, where you’ll learn to write in Japanese and receive your name written in elegant calligraphy. Next, enjoy a tea ceremony where you make your own tea and relax in the peaceful atmosphere of the house. You can also take a stroll through the quiet, scenic countryside neighborhood. Finish the tour with a delicious lunch featuring Kobe beef in yakiniku style, traditional dishes like oden, and matcha jelly for dessert. The tender Kobe beef melts in your mouth—perfect for those who want to experience authentic Japanese culture and cuisine in one visit.

What you'll see and do
Kobe
We will visit Kotonoha, a traditional Japanese house café. The café is located in an old-style Japanese home. Our first activity will be Japanese calligraphy with a professional calligraphy teacher. She will show you how to write in Japanese and also create your name in beautiful calligraphy. This is a wonderful way to experience traditional Japanese culture.
60 minutes here
Kobe
Our second activity is a traditional Japanese tea ceremony. You will make your own tea and relax inside the beautiful old Japanese house. This experience offers a calm and peaceful atmosphere, and you can also take a walk around the neighborhood to enjoy the charm of the Japanese countryside.
60 minutes here
Kobe
The final activity is lunch. The restaurant serves Kobe beef in a yakiniku (grilled meat) style, along with traditional Japanese dishes such as oden and various appetizers, all served with white rice. At the end of the meal, you’ll enjoy a cup of herbal medicine tea (yakuzen-cha) and matcha jelly for dessert. The Kobe beef is incredibly tender—it melts in your mouth. If you want to experience both premium Kobe beef and authentic local Japanese cuisine, this is the perfect place.
60 minutes here

A great Kobe experience
A very traditional home/ restaurant with paper doors and mats on the floors. The ladies for the calligraphy and tea ceremony were excellent. Nozo was the best in all aspects. Which included a translation of the Japanese language for us. The meal was outstanding. The Kobe beef was served hibachi style along with several side dishes. The whole was well worth the time. It was a very personal and intimate experience in a private residential setting. I would highly recommend this cultural tour. A more personal look and taste of a life in kobe.
